Abstract :This study is derived from a master\\\'s thesis. The aim of the study is to investigate the effects of panopticon on job stress and organizational depression, the direction and level of these effects. The population of the study consists of 456 employees of Bpet Energy operating in Ankara, Mersin and Istanbul. Face-to-face survey method was used as a data collection tool. First of all, Correlation analysis was performed to reveal the relationships between the variables determined and then Regression analysis was performed. According to the results of the research, Panopticon and its sub-dimensions do not affect job stress. According to another result, Panopticon and its sub-dimensions (positive panopticon, negative panopticon, extrinsic responsibility, awareness of being monitored) have a significant and positive effect on organizational depression. It is seen that while feeling safe when the organization is being monitored eliminates stress, on the other hand, it may cause depression by falling into the fear of unemployment caused by the fear of being unemployed brought by the future anxiety against the possibility of being fired if they make mistakes in their attitudes, speeches, and work.Keywords : Panoptikon, İş Stresi, Örgütsel Depresyon, Gözetleme, Dijitalleşme, İşyerinde Mahremiyet
